2025-01-13 13:20:03 小编:91581手游
在现代网络管理中,网络连接的故障排除是每个网络工程师及IT人员日常工作的重要组成部分。在这一过程中,使用ping和telnet工具是诊断网络问题的基本方式之一。然而,用户在实际操作中常常会遇到telnet端口不通ping通的现象,这给排查问题带来了困扰。本文将探讨这一现象的原因以及相应的解决方法。
首先,我们要明确ping和telnet的作用。ping是用来测试网络连通性的工具,它通过发送ICMP请求包判断目标主机是否可达。而telnet则是用来测试特定端口的连通性,如常用于远程登录到服务器。在网络正常的情况下,一般来说,ping通的主机,telnet端口也应当是通的。但是在某些情况下,我们可能会遇到ping通,却无法telnet的情况。
这种情况通常会由多种因素引起。首先,可能是目标服务器的防火墙策略导致的。许多服务器为了安全起见,会配置防火墙只允许特定的端口接受外部连接请求。例如,80端口(HTTP)和443端口(HTTPS)一般是开放的,而23端口(telnet)或者其他非标准服务的端口可能会被限制。此时,ping命令能够正常工作,因为它专注于网络层,而telnet则需要更高层次的TCP连接,这就导致telnet失败。
其次,网络设备(如路由器、交换机等)的配置问题也可能导致这一现象。某些网络设备可能会对入站和出站的连接做出不同的处理,导致外部访问某些端口时失败。例如,可能是因路由器上的ACL(访问控制列表)限制了对telnet端口的访问。
另外,目标主机的服务未开启也会引发telnet不通的情况。假如用户试图telnet到的端口上没有相应的服务运行,即便网络连接正常,telnet请求也会失败。举个例子,如果用户尝试连接到某个数据库服务,但该服务未启动或未配置为监听该端口,就会出现telnet不通的情况。
为了解决telnet端口不通ping通的问题,用户可以采取一些步骤。首先,可以手动检查目标设备的防火墙设置,上面是否有关联的规则集。如果是自己管理的设备,可以尝试临时关闭防火墙,看能否ping通。其次,可以验证网络设备上的ACL设置,确保没有对telnet端口的访问控制。必要时,可以与网络管理员沟通,以确保没有其他配置导致问题。
最后,确认目标主机上所需的服务是否在运行,使用netstat等工具检查港口状态,确保telnet所需的端口已正被监听。如果以上步骤都未能解决问题,可以考虑使用一些网络测试工具,如tracert追踪路由路径,帮助判断是否是某个路由环节出现了故障。
总之,telnet端口不通ping通是一个相对复杂的问题,其背后隐藏的原因可能与网络配置、防火墙、服务状态等多方面有关。通过细致的排查和科学的思路,网络工程师和IT人员可以找到并解决问题,从而确保网络的良好连接与通畅运行。
最新软件
火爆软件
生活服务丨136.41MB丨2025-01-13
系统工具丨34.62MB丨2025-01-13
购物优惠丨6.08MB丨2025-01-13
生活服务丨54.96MB丨2025-01-13
旅游出行丨82.14MB丨2025-01-13
学习教育丨50.04MB丨2025-01-13
系统工具丨89.11MB丨2024-11-25
系统工具丨45.91MB丨2024-12-15
系统工具丨28.45MB丨2024-11-29
效率办公丨46.78MB丨2024-12-06
视频直播丨20.26MB丨2024-11-28
生活服务丨101.68MB丨2025-01-09